Transaction fc31ed6cb1bf5d2720b80461817fae6de1fe184f806139bad8ec5f76f6c89ba4
1 Input
1 Output
-
fc31ed6cb1bf5d2720b80461817fae6de1fe184f806139bad8ec5f76f6c89ba4:0
- value
- 529900
- script pubkey
- OP_0 OP_PUSHBYTES_20 189f5e6141027681e78b4cc36db627abfb8b633a
- address
- bc1qrz04uc2pqfmgreutfnpkmd3840ackce6tv70yx